How Does the BXL Veterinary Ultrasonic Instrument Detect Pig Back Fat?

The BXL veterinary ultrasonic instrument works by emitting high-frequency sound waves into the pig’s body. As the sound waves pass through tissues, they are reflected by structures such as muscle, fat, and organs. The ultrasound machine captures the reflected waves and produces a visual image of the pig’s body composition.

In terms of back fat measurement, the ultrasound provides:

  • Accurate Back Fat Thickness Measurement: By measuring the thickness of the fat layer located along the pig’s back, the BXL instrument provides an accurate and reliable assessment of fat reserves.
  • Real-Time Imaging: The ultrasound delivers real-time results, allowing for immediate evaluation and decision-making during routine health assessments or at specific intervals.
  • Non-Invasive Process: Unlike traditional methods such as biopsy or direct measurement, the BXL ultrasound is non-invasive, making it stress-free for the pig and minimizing discomfort.

Why Is Measuring Back Fat Important in Pigs?

Measuring back fat thickness in pigs is essential for a variety of reasons:

  • Meat Quality: The amount of back fat is a crucial determinant of pork quality, affecting factors like tenderness, flavor, and juiciness. Pork with too much fat may be less desirable, while too little fat may result in lean, dry meat.
  • Growth and Feed Efficiency: Monitoring back fat helps farmers assess whether pigs are growing at an optimal rate. Too much fat accumulation can indicate inefficient feeding, while insufficient fat may suggest that pigs are not reaching their full potential.
  • Breeding Selection: Pigs with optimal back fat levels are more likely to produce high-quality offspring. Identifying these animals through ultrasound enables breeders to make more informed selection decisions.
  • Health Monitoring: Excessive fat may be a sign of obesity, which can lead to health problems, including reproductive issues, lower fertility, and metabolic disorders. Early detection helps prevent these health concerns.
